Output 73158c2867ad32d611de98793d3fdfa1e7fb8f8e10597b61cd7b0023e667d100:0

value
102734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b9267b73e0a2a0b881131905251da3584caf976 OP_EQUAL
address
3LFQUtjZAd5DUUQ1tEGnTLdyEUKy46mVRD
transaction
73158c2867ad32d611de98793d3fdfa1e7fb8f8e10597b61cd7b0023e667d100
spent
true